Landrum embodies the perfect blend of small-town charm and sophisticated mountain living. Just minutes from Greenville, SC, and Asheville, NC, the area is renowned for its mild four-season climate, world-class outdoor recreation, and vibrant equestrian culture. Nearby stables and equestrian centers abound, including Clear View Farm (a premier hunter-jumper facility offering boarding, training, and lessons right in Landrum), Latigo Farm at the base of Glassy Mountain, The Cliffs Equestrian Center, and easy access to the Foothills Equestrian Nature Center and the renowned Tryon International Equestrian Center. This is true horse country, where trails and pastures meet mountain vistas. The region also features charming vineyards and wineries that celebrate the foothills’ growing wine scene, including nearby favorites like Eagle Mountain Vineyards & Winery along Highway 11 and others in the Tryon area—just a short drive for tastings amid rolling hills and mountain backdrops. For sightseeing and adventure, the property sits in the heart of it all. Hike or drive to iconic Table Rock State Park for dramatic granite cliffs and panoramic views. Explore Caesars Head State Park, with its famous overlook and Devil’s Kitchen trail, and the breathtaking open-air Fred W. Symmes Chapel—known as Pretty Place, perched on the escarpment for sunrise services with 75-mile vistas. The Glassy Mountain Chapel itself, right in The Cliffs at Glassy community, offers an intimate mountaintop sanctuary for reflection or special events. Additional nearby gems include Bald Rock Heritage Preserve and the endless trails of the Mountain Bridge Wilderness Area.
